Approved May 6, 1980.

CHAPTER 466

(House Bill 1403)

AN ACT concerning

Calvert County - Stormwater Management Districts

FOR the purpose of requiring the County Commissioners of
Calvert County to determine whether interest shall be
charged property owners along with payments of the
costs for a stormwater management repair or
construction project; requiring the County
Commissioners of Calvert County to adopt by ordinance,
a comprehensive stormwater management plan under
certain circumstances; excluding certain interest and
other charges from the benefit charge fixed and levied
upon real property to meet the costs of a stormwater
management construction project; providing for the
maintenance of the drainage system; and relating
generally to stormwater management districts in Calvert
County.

BY adding to

Article 25 - County Commissioners

Section 155B

Annotated Code of Maryland

(1973 Replacement Volume and 1979 Supplement)

SECTION 1. BE IT ENACTED BY TH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F
MARYLAND, That section(s) of the Annotated Code of Maryland
be repealed, amended, or enacted to read as follows:

Article 25 - County Commissioners

155B.

(A) THE COUNTY COMMISSIONERS OF CALVERT COUNTY, BY
ORDINANCE, MAY PROVIDE FOR THE ESTABLISHMENT OF STORMWATER
MANAGEMENT DISTRICTS. PRIOR TO THE ADOPTION OF AN ORDINANCE
ESTABLISHING STORMWATER MANAGEMENT DISTRICTS, THE COUNTY
COMMISSIONERS SHALL ADOPT BY ORDINANCE, A COMPREHENSIVE
STORMWATER MANAGEMENT PLAN. TWO-THIRDS OF THE PROPERTY
OWNERS, OR THE OWNERS OF TWO-THIRDS OF THE PROPERTY WITHIN
THE AREA AFFECTED (DEFINED FOR THIS SECTION AS THE CRITICAL
AREA GENERATING THE RUN-OFF WATER AND ALL OF THE AREA
FLOODED) MAY PRESENT A WRITTEN PETITION TO THE COUNTY
COMMISSIONERS REQUESTING THE CREATION OF A STORMWATER
MANAGEMENT DISTRICT AND A STORMWATER MANAGEMENT PROJECT.
